According to IEC 60050 definition, live working is “an activity in which a worker makes contact with energized parts or encroaches inside the live working zone with either parts of his or her body or with tools, devices or equipment”. In France, grid live working is supervised by the Ministry of Labour and the Ministry of Industry. In the early sixties, both ministries together with transmission and distribution supply operators (TSO and DSO) decided to create the “Live Working Committee” to entrust all grid live work regulation. Until 1976, the Portuguese electrical sector was fragmented into several companies operating at regional or even local scale. In the aftermaths of the April Revolution of1974, there was large-scale nationalization program to which the electrical sector was no exception.
